Game Theory
Lightspeed
7 episodes
6 months ago
Game Theory, a new video podcast from Lightspeed and Goldman Sachs, in partnership with McKinsey, takes a look behind the curtain of the industry-defining gaming & interactive technology companies—and explores how play is changing everything. Featuring insights and untold stories from Founders, CEOs & Presidents—including David Baszucki (Roblox), Sarah Bond (Microsoft Xbox), Strauss Zelnick (Take-Two Interactive), Matt Bromberg (Unity), and more—the series dives into how play has shaped consumer behavior and technological innovation for decades. In a candid format, each episode explores a different dimension of play, and how it has influenced the guest's personal and professional lives. Game Theory is co-hosted by Moritz Baier-Lentz, Partner at Lightspeed, and Hemal Thaker, Managing Director at Goldman Sachs.

Niantic Spatial: Play & the Real World (John Hanke, Moritz Baier-Lentz, Hemal Thaker)
Video games have long been maligned for contributing to the already sedentary lifestyle of most modern people. But our first interactions with play during childhood—pretend games and imaginative adventures—are inherently physical. Cue the arrival of Pokémon GO, a pioneer in location-based gaming that has brought hundreds of millions of players back into the great outdoors. In this episode, co-hosts Moritz Baier-Lentz and Hemal Thaker talk with John Hanke, Founder and CEO of Niantic Spatial, the developer behind Pokémon GO. John shares how his history at Google Maps, early location-based experiences like Ingress, and Niantic Spatial’s ambitions have shaped a company that’s known for its games, but has—along the way—built geospatial models for blending the real and virtual worlds. The three also explore the evolution of location-based games beyond phones, making AI “street smart,” and Niantic Spatial’s progress in building a map of our world that’s designed for the understanding of machines, including humanoid robots.
